静态真空对超声喷流气体团簇制备的实验研究

摘    要:研究了靶室静态真空对超声喷流气体团簇产生和制备的影响.通过瑞利散射方法测量了不同静态真空度下超声喷流氩团簇的尺度和密度参数,发现在喷嘴出口附近团簇尺度和密度受静态真空度的影响较小;在距离喷嘴较远处,氩气团簇存在同氢气团簇类似的自限制效应,验证了自限制效应在团簇制备、输运过程中的重要作用.该结果对于建造基于激光聚变原理的桌面中子源具有较大的参考意义,可据此简化真空装置以降低运行和维护成本.

Influence of static vacuum on the preparation of cluster of supersonic gas jet

Abstract:The influence of static vacuum on the cluster size and density of the supersonic gas jet is studied by Raleigh scattering method. It is found that in a range from 3×10-4 Pa to 9.9×104 Pa, the static vacuum has very little influence on the cluster size and desnity. The self-limiting effect which was found for hydrogen cluster at liquid nitrogen temperature is also found for argon cluster at positions far from the nozzle, and it is found to play an important role in the cluster generation and transporation. The result is very valuable for the construction of the desktop neutron source based on laser fusion method, since the pumps and device to supply the vacuum can be reduced and simplified.
